Output 27a616ba8244c6641c97856f418906f91345959b2e7789ff1984514b08799038:52

value
1059514
script pubkey
OP_0 OP_PUSHBYTES_20 cb8bd88ccb631f053924948e628c8dc24d1df8c2
address
bc1qew9a3rxtvv0s2wfyjj8x9rydcfx3m7xz39tvtz
transaction
27a616ba8244c6641c97856f418906f91345959b2e7789ff1984514b08799038
spent
true